             TABLE 10.1    LANGUAGE COMPLEXITY: STEVE JOBS VERSUS
                        BILL GATES

                                                     BILL GATES,
                                                     INTERNATIONAL
                                  STEVE JOBS,        CONSUMER
             PRESENTER/EVENT      MACWORLD           ELECTRONICS SHOW

             Jobs’s 2007 Macworld Keynote and Gates’s 2007 CES Keynote
             Average words/       10.5               21.6
             sentence

             Lexical density      16.5%               21.0%
             Hard words            2.9%               5.11%

             Fog index              5.5               10.7
             Jobs’s 2008 Macworld Keynote and Gates’s 2008 CES Keynote

             Average words/       13.79               18.23
             sentence

             Lexical density      15.76%              24.52%
             Hard words            3.18%              5.2%
             Fog index             6.79                9.37

                Where Gates is obtuse, Jobs is clear. Where Gates is abstract,
             Jobs is tangible. Where Gates is complex, Jobs is simple.
